fopen

    -1热度

    1回答

    我正在写一个写入文件的Linux上的简单代码。该文件将存储在特定的路径(不是可执行文件所在的路径)。问题是当我执行代码时,程序终止于段错误(核心转储) 这是我的代码: #include <stdio.h> int main() { FILE * pFile; char buffer[] = { 'x' , 'y' , 'z' }; pFile = fopen (

    2热度

    2回答

    我现在正试图在matlab r2016b mac版本中处理大型csv(200万行)。 csv的一小部分如下所示。 user_id,video_id,session,new_speed,old_speed,new_time,old_time,event_type,event_time a74fe6d4812fa93a1afa1a6a334ebdda,af7f974d395a4adddc8ab17a

    1热度

    1回答

    我正在使用MATLAB R2017a,并且我想在运行脚本的文件夹中创建一个新的二进制文件。 我正在以管理员身份运行matlab,否则它无权创建文件。以下内容返回合法的文件ID: fileID = fopen('mat.bin','w'); 但该文件在c:\ windows \ system32中创建。 然后我尝试了以下创建我的脚本文件夹中的文件: filePath=fullfile(mfile

    -3热度

    1回答

    如果我用以下任何一种方式打开C文件,那么fopen可以正常工作。 fopen("file.txt", "w"); fopen("/file.txt", "w"); fopen("dir/file.txt", "w"); 如果我把一个斜杠“/”前目录名(在Windows的情况下,或“\”),如下所示,然后fopen失败(返回NULL)。 fopen("/dir/file.txt", "w")

    2热度

    1回答

    我创建简单的代码,检查文件是否存在,并创建一个如果返回false 在Windows中的每件事情都很好,代码工作,但是当我上传代码到linux 服务器不工作,因为每个文件按此顺序创建两次 。 if (file_exists(self::COOKIES_FOLDER.DS.$email . ".txt") === false) { $fh = fopen(self::COOKIES_

    0热度

    1回答

    ,我有以下的代码段($settings是一些数据): $file = fopen("D:\\this\\is\\the\\path.php", "w"); fwrite($file, $settings); fclose($file); 而且我得到这个错误: fopen(D:\this\is\the\path.php): failed to open stream: Invalid arg

    -2热度

    1回答

    我想使用PHP创建一个文件,但问题是所需的文件没有名称,但只有一个扩展名。我该怎么做? 目前的代码只是没有文件,但它也不会给我一个错误。 fopen('.extension', 'w')or die('ERROR MESSAGE');

    1热度

    1回答

    下载不管我使用的功能坏掉的图片文件: copy("http:" . $imglink, "images/" . substr($imglink, 34)); //or file_put_contents("images/" . substr($imglink, 34), file_get_contents("http:" . $imglink)); //or file_put_conten

    0热度

    2回答

    我有很多文件块,我需要使用PHP fopen函数合并它们。但是,我对内存使用感到担忧。 例如,我在split_hash.txt中列出了约100个文件,每个文件约为100MB。在这里,我将它们结合在一起: <?php $hash = file_get_contents("split_hash.txt"); $list = explode("\r\n",$hash); $fp = fopen("

    -1热度

    1回答

    我试图导入CSV的多行到SQL,并且此代码仅使用少量行数(例如75行)导入,它会成功,但是当我试图在SQL中导入多行数据(例如700000行)时,会出现。 if(($handle = fopen($_FILES['file']['tmp_name'], 'r')) !== false) { $header = fgetcsv($handle); while(($dat